Before we understand about United Nations let us understand what was the main reason behind establishment of United Nations. The main reason was failure of League of Nations. The First World War was from 1914 -1918. After the First World War many nations felt there was a need for an organisation which would maintain international peace and prevent war. This lead to establishment of League of Nations. League of Nations responsibility was to prevent any war from happening and maintain peace. However League of Nations miserably failed to prevent Second World War from happening. After Second World War the United Nations Organisation was formed.

The United Nations Organisation has its headquarters in New York, U.S.A. currently there are 193 Member nations who are a part of U.N.O. The United Nations organization works with the assistance of 6 major organs and various specialized Agencies. The six Major organs in no particular order are Security Council, International Court of Justice, General Assembly Trusteeship Council, Economic and Social Council and the Secretariat. The United Nations flag is light blue in colour and has the UN emblem in the Centre UN emblem is basically twin olive branches which embrace the polar map of the world. On 20th October 1947 the flag was adopted. The United Nations Organization has 6 official languages which are in no particular order Arabic, Chinese, French, Russian, Spanish and English. Let us look at major achievements of United Nations Organization. First Major Achievements of United Nations is the Sustainable Development Goals. The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) were adopted by all United Nations Member States in 2015 as a universal call to action to end poverty, protect the planet and ensure that all people enjoy peace and prosperity by 2030. In total there are 17 Sustainable goals. The agency which plays a major role in implementation of SDG’s is United Nations Development Programme (UNDP). Following are some of the sustainable development goals Zero Hunger , No poverty ,Gender Equality, Climate Action and Quality Education.
United Nations has also made one of the most remarkable achievements in humanitarian aspects. United Nations General Assembly adopted Universal Declaration of Human Rights on 10th December 1948. This was the Primary Step which characterized basic human rights and laid a step stone for human rights.
United Nations has significantly worked towards cultural rights. UNESCO – United Nations Educational Scientific Cultural organization adopted World heritage Convention in 1972. It connects preservation of cultural properties and Natural conservation. This is one of the significant achievements of UN because this is the fundamental step to protect history and culture.
